Memphis Drops Middle Tennessee Series
Mar 08, 2017 | Baseball
MEMPHIS, Tenn. – Memphis dropped the series to Middle Tennessee with an 11-7 game Wednesday night at FedExPark. The Tigers (7-5) will be back in action at home against Southern Illinois for a three game series that runs Friday, Saturday and Sunday.
A five-run fifth inning was too much for the Tigers to overcome. Memphis committed four errors in the game, two coming in the second inning and two in the fourth inning.
Memphis led early, after scoring two runs in the bottom of the second. Trent Turner drove in the go-ahead run with a single through the left side.
The Blue Raiders tied it right back up with a two-out solo home run to left field in the top of the third inning. Memphis gifted Middle Tennessee two more runs in the top of the fourth after back-to-back two-out errors in the inning. The five-run inning put the game away at 9-4.
Senior left-handed pitcher Ryan Garner tossed the final two innings of scoreless baseball. He struck out one batter and didn't allow a single base runner.
Zach Schritenthal, Chris Carrier, Brandon Grudzielanek and Trent Turner each had two hits in the game.
Memphis and Southern Illinois will start up the three-game series Friday at 6:30 p.m.
